Would you notice an extra 55 BHP
May sound like a daft question but currently I have 355 BHP, thats assuming it running as it should.
I can have a re-map and new air filters fitted that should lift power to 410 BHP. An increase of 55 bhp or to look at it another way +15%. I appreciate that +55 BHP in a 320D for example would be very noticable (I had mine mapped from 177 to 215 but that was an increase of +21%) But in a car that already has 355??? What do you think? The cost is £895 |

Assuming all other variables being equal
That is, that torque and hp increase across the entire range, then a 55hp increase is equivalent to dropping the weight of the car by the equivalent of 250kgs, or the weight of 3 large adults
So, have you noticed a difference in perfomance bewteen your car fully loaded with passengers and just you driving, because that's exactly the same difference you can expect with the tune |

Unfortunately, 400hp+ is not realistic from remap alone, we would expect to get the car to just under 400hp (380-395hp) The price for this upgrade, including before and after power run is £895.00+VAT However, Kleemann have strongly advised, to get the best gains out of the car with the re-map, they would suggest to upgrade the Headers, and swap to a 200cel Sports Catalyst, which will allow the engine to breathe a lot more efficiently, with a massive release of restriction from the original catalytic converters which strangle the big 55 motor. Gains then up to 420hp will be achieved ( +60/80hp), with a massive improvement felt at the top of the RPM where the car will rev out a lot crisper with more punch. The Kleemann headers + 200cel sports cat’s are £1495.00+VAT We offer an option for Heat Treatment on Headers, which provides noticeable improvements, especially for N/A Motors (some photos attached of a E63 Log Type Header from Kleemann that we have recently installed), this stops a lot of heat conduction to the motor, and more importantly, keeps the heat inside the headers to promote hotter gas and hence quicker gas velocity through the header (hotter gas travels quicker to colder area).
